Title
Ordinance amending Title 6, Chapter 6.46 of the South San Francisco Municipal Code (Tobacco Retailer Permit) to adopt by reference Title 4, Chapter 4.98 of the San Mateo County Ordinance Code, and repealing in its entirety Title 6, Chapter 6.47 (Sales of Flavored Tobacco Products, Pharmacy Sales of Tobacco Products, and Sales of Electronic Smoking Devices Prohibited). (second reading)
Body
WHEREAS, in 2008 the City of South San Francisco (City) adopted by reference San Mateo County Ordinance Code (SMCOC) Chapter 4.98 (Tobacco Retailer Permit) as South San Francisco Municipal Code (SSFMC) Title 6, Chapter 6.46; and
WHEREAS, the City's adoption by reference of SMCOC Chapter 4.98 serves as the mechanism for the County of San Mateo's (County) enforcement of Tobacco Retailer Permits in the City; and
WHEREAS, effective June 22, 2023, the County Board of Supervisors repealed the former SMCOC Chapter 4.98 (Tobacco Retailer Permit) and enacted a new SMCOC Chapter 4.98; and
WHEREAS, the County's newly adopted SMCOC Chapter 4.98 strengthens enforcement of tobacco retailer permit requirements, requires two inspections per year of all retailers; establishes retailing restrictions for new businesses; updates the definitions of tobacco products to include synthetic nicotine and to align with the state's definition of tobacco products, including flavored tobacco products; and prohibits issuing new tobacco retailer permits for any location within 1,000 feet of a "youth populated area" or within 500 feet of an existing tobacco retailer; and
WHEREAS, the County identified that the restrictions under the newly adopted SMCOC Chapter 4.98 are necessary to clarify County Health's authority to enforce within incorporated areas and to reduce logistical challenges associated with administering and enforcing several city ordinances; and
